In simple terms, shelf storage dividers are organisational accessories designed to separate items on shelves into neat, individual sections. They prevent clutter, improve accessibility, and make storage spaces more efficient.
Here’s why Australians love shelf storage dividers: they create order, protect items, and maximise shelf space. Whether in kitchens, wardrobes, pantries, or home offices, these dividers keep belongings upright, easy to find, and visually appealing.
Types of Shelf Storage Dividers
Australian homes can choose from a variety of shelf storage dividers to suit different organisational needs:
-
Adjustable Dividers – Flexible dividers that fit different shelf widths.
-
Fixed Dividers – Permanent partitions for sturdy and structured separation.
-
Metal or Wire Dividers – Strong options ideal for heavier items like books or kitchenware.
-
Plastic or Acrylic Dividers – Lightweight, easy-to-clean solutions for wardrobes or craft shelves.
-
Stackable or Modular Dividers – Allow vertical separation for better use of shelf height.
-
Sliding Dividers – Customisable dividers that can be repositioned easily.

How to Choose Shelf Storage Dividers
Selecting the right shelf dividers involves considering shelf size, item type, and style:
-
Measure your shelves – Ensure dividers fit the width and height of your shelving units.
-
Identify what you’re storing – Heavy items need sturdy dividers; lighter items can use acrylic or plastic options.
-
Choose material & finish – Select dividers that complement your décor and are easy to maintain.
-
Check adjustability – Flexible dividers allow for future rearrangements and changing storage needs.
-
Consider durability – Ensure dividers can withstand regular use and weight of stored items.
By following these steps, shelf storage dividers will be both functional and stylish.

Styling & Usage Advice
Practical tips for using shelf storage dividers effectively:
-
Group similar items together – Store like items in each section for easy identification.
-
Use vertical space – Stackable or tiered dividers maximise shelf height.
-
Match décor – Choose dividers in finishes or colours that complement existing furniture.
-
Rotate seasonal items – Adjust compartments for seasonal homeware, shoes, or kitchen items.
-
Label compartments – Helps maintain order and quick identification.
Proper styling ensures shelf storage dividers enhance organisation while maintaining a designer look.
